Transaction 8ec000723e2095c48be2a309d9fe3f155b6b57bac3df25f943c35c4f12d7f5fe
1 Input
1 Output
-
8ec000723e2095c48be2a309d9fe3f155b6b57bac3df25f943c35c4f12d7f5fe:0
- value
- 662576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f8e2603370955b5b1fe272e3b0c3124616589a0 OP_EQUAL
- address
- 3DKU2ZDMND52jocPAecWdxcyCYGuhjdv1C